Musc Mayssane
Fragrance notes
Character
Freesia and blackcurrant syrup burst forward with a bright, candied fruitiness that feels like walking through a garden market at midday. The freesia brings a clean floral lift while the blackcurrant syrup adds a thick, jammy sweetness that leans playful rather than refined. This opening is loud and unapologetically sugary, aiming to catch attention immediately with its cheerful energy.
Rose and patchouli take over with a softer, slightly earthy floral heart. The rose stays fresh and dewy rather than powdered, and the patchouli grounds the sweetness without turning dark or heavy. Vanilla and white woods in the base add a smooth, creamy warmth, while ambroxan gives the blend a modern, slightly mineral glow that keeps it from feeling dated or overly sentimental.
Musc Mayssane suits someone who enjoys a fragrance that feels like sunlight on a busy terrace, surrounded by flowers and fresh fruit. It is cheerful and outgoing, though the syrup note can feel a bit dense for those who prefer airy, subtle compositions. The person who wants a gentle whisper of petals will find this too bold. This is a fragrance built around a happy, radiant mood. It settles on vanilla.
